Spaghetti Fry

image

Ingredients:
500g spaghetti
2-3 tbsp spoon oil
Green chillies
1-2 tsp chillies
Black pepper
3 garlic cloves
Green, yellow and red pepper
200g mushrooms
Chopped coriander

Method:
1. Fry all the spices in oil.
2. Add the vegetables till cooked.
3. Add boiled spaghetti. Mix together and serve with chopped coriander.

Note: you can add any other vegetables you would like.

Chicken Spaghetti

image

Ingredients:
Chicken breast
Onions (for frying and blending)
Green chillies
Crushed ginger and garlic
Fresh tomatoes or tinned tomatoes
Peppers
Carrots
Sweetcorn
Coconut cream

Method:
1. Brown onions then add the spices including green chilies, ginger and garlic.
2. Add the chopped fresh tomatoes or tinned or both till oil bubbles appear ath the top.
3. Add the diced chicken breast and leave to cook.
4. Meanwhile blend the peppers, sweetcorn, onions and carrots together. Then add to the chicken. Leave to cook for a few minutes.
5. Finally add the coconut cream. Once melted, combine and switch off the gas.
6. Add the boiled and drained spaghetti to the sauce. Garnish with chopped coriander, red onions and fried samosa pastry ( or crushed pringles)

Lamb Spaghetti

image

Ingredients:
1lb lamb
1 large Onion
Red chilli powder to
Crushed green chillies to taste
1 tsp turmeric powder
1 tsp coriander powder
1 tsp cumin powder
Whole spices; cinnamon, cloves, cardamon pods.
2 fresh tomatoes
1/2 chopped tomatoes tin
Fresh coriander
Ginger and garlic paste
Salt to taste

Method:
1. Cook the usual meat curry using the above ingredients. Be aware not to add only a little water to the meat when cooking as the onions and tomatoe tin will produce the sauce (masala) which is soaked up by the spaghetti later. It shouldn’t be watery.
2. Whilst waiting for the meat to cook, break the spaghetti into four pieces and boil in a separate pot.
3. Once meat is cooked and masala created toss the spaghetti into the meat and mix till well combined.
4. Garnish with coriander and some fried onions and potatoes and…
image
… Serve with the following condiments:
Cucumber – chopped into small cubes
Tomatoes chopped into small cubes
Red onion – diced
Fried onions
Fried potatoes – grated then deep fried
Eggs – boiled then grated/cubed

Note: you can also add a dash of tomato sauce before serving.

Spaghetti Meatballs

image

Ingredients for sauce:
350g pasatta
2 tbsp tomato puree
salt to taste
3 cloves garlic sliced
1 tsp tumeric powder
1 tsp red chilli powder
1 medium onion

Ingredients for meatballs:
500g Chicken breast
Crushed green chillies
Coriander powder
salt to taste
pepper
1 slice of bread
1 small onion

Method:
1. Blend together all the meatball ingredients and shape into balls.
3. To make the sauce firstly fry the garlic slices in oil. Add dry spices and sauté for a few minutes.
4. Then add diced onions. Leave to cook till they soften. 5. Now add the pasatta and let it simmer for 5-10 minutes until oil bubbles appear at the top.
6. Then add the meatballs and let it cook.
7. Boil spaghetti and pour the meatball sauce on top before serving.

Serve with sliced tomatoes, onions and peppers.

Coconut Spaghetti

image

Ingredients:
1 tbsp ground peanut
1 tbsp white poppy seeds (Khus khus)
1 tsp cumin powder
1 tspn chilli powder
2 fresh tomatoes
1 chicken cut into pieces
2 &  1/4 tbsp crushed ginger
1 &  1/4 tbsp crushed garlic
1 &  1/8 tbsp green chillies
3 glasses water
3/4lb Spaghetti
1 tin coconut milk
1/4 piece of coconut cream block
1tbsp chickpea flour
2 tsp crushed red chillies

Method:
1. Make a paste with the first 5 ingredients on the list till tomatoes using a mini blender.
2. Warm a little oil and add the chicken. Allow to cook till most of the water is burnt away but leave a little so not totally dry.
3. Add salt to taste, ginger, garlic, green chillies and the blended paste. Allow to cook.
4. Then add 3 glasses water and cook on med heat.
5. Once half the water is burnt away mix in a paste created from the tin of coconut milk, coconut cream, flour and water. Allow to cook.
6.  In a seperate pan add 1 sliced clove of garlic cut when golden do not use. But add the red crushed chillies and mix thoroughly. Then add this to chicken mix.
7 . boil the spaghetti in water. Drain and add to the chicken mix. Combine it all together. Garnish with coriander. Serve with red onions and fried and flaked filo pastry (samosa par).
